Unlocking the power of data: How hotels are transforming guest experiences

According to 'The Future of Hotel Data' study, the hospitality industry is embracing data-driven strategies to enhance personalization, streamline operations, and maximize revenue, yet challenges like fragmented systems and poor data quality persist. Hotels that integrate AI and unified data platforms are leading the way in creating seamless, personalized guest experiences while optimizing profitability.

From the total of the 200 hoteliers surveyed, 46.11% identified CRM and loyalty systems as priority areas for data quality improvements, which are seen as critical to strengthening guest relationships and increasing lifetime value.

The hospitality sector -very related to the casino industry- is undergoing a digital transformation, with data at the core of innovation and growth. According to the latest The Future of Hotel Data report by Hapi and Revinate, while over half of hotel professionals work with data daily, nearly 50% struggle with accessing it effectively, and 40% cite disconnected systems as their biggest obstacle.

These challenges impact the ability to deliver personalized guest experiences. Incomplete or inaccurate data prevents hotels from offering tailored recommendations and targeted promotions, limiting customer engagement and repeat business. Experts highlight the importance of integrating systems from reservations, CRM, and guest services to build comprehensive 360-degree guest profiles.

AI is emerging as a crucial tool in this transformation. By leveraging machine learning, hotels can anticipate guest needs, automate operational tasks, and dynamically optimize marketing and pricing strategies. Predictive personalization allows properties to suggest upgrades, dining options, and tailored experiences, while AI-driven automation frees staff to focus on high-touch services.

Loyalty programs and CRM data remain a top priority. Nearly half of respondents identified these areas as needing improvement to ensure accurate guest information and seamless recognition across touchpoints. Hotels that invest in clean, unified data gain a competitive edge, fostering stronger relationships and driving revenue through targeted engagement.

Industry leaders agree that the next era of hospitality will depend on real-time, system-wide data access, integrated AI, and secure, privacy-compliant technology solutions. Those who successfully harness these tools will enhance guest satisfaction, optimize operations, and secure their position in a competitive market.

With a clear vision and actionable insights, hoteliers are now equipped to transform data into meaningful business outcomes, delivering both personalized experiences for guests and improved profitability for their properties.
